In May, Serra Negra, Brazil, experiences a notable shift in precipitation patterns as the rainy season begins to taper off. With an average rainfall of 44 mm (1.7 in) over just 4 days, this marks a significant decline from the heavier downpours of earlier months. March, for instance, received 111 mm (4.4 in) over 14 days, while January saw a generous 198 mm (7.8 in) across 17 days. As May ushers in drier conditions, it sets the stage for an even more arid June, where precipitation drops to a mere 23 mm (0.9 in). In May, Serra Negra, Brazil, experiences a noticeable drop in humidity, averaging 79%—a contrast to the more humid summer months of January through April, when levels hover around 88% to 84%. As the cooler months approach, humidity continues to decline, reaching 77% in June and tapering to 72% by July. This trend reflects the transition towards a drier climate, with the region enjoying a slight reprieve from the heavy humidity of earlier in the year. In Serra Negra, Brazil, daylight duration evolves throughout the year, showcasing a fascinating interplay of light and seasonal transitions. January enjoys the longest days, basking in 13 hours of daylight before gradually tapering to 11 hours in April and May. This period marks a gentle shift into the cooler months, as daylight remains steady. As June and July arrive, daylight minimizes to 10 hours, reflecting the depths of winter. However, as spring approaches in August, the days lengthen once more, returning to 11 hours by the end of summer. Ultimately, October heralds a climb back to 12 hours, culminating in the lush returns of November and December, where the days again stretch to 13 hours. May and January present quite different weather patterns. In May, temperatures range from a cool minimum of 2°C (35°F) to a warm maximum of 30°C (87°F), with an average of 19°C (67°F). This month experiences relatively low precipitation with only 44 mm (1.7 in) over about 4 days, and humidity sits at a comfortable 79%.
In contrast, January boasts a much warmer climate, with temperatures ranging from a minimum of 15°C (60°F) to a high of 35°C (96°F), averaging 24°C (76°F). However, January is significantly wetter, receiving 198 mm (7.8 in) of rain over approximately 17 days, combined with a higher humidity level of 88%.
